Herman Dahle
Herman Bjorn Dahle was a two-term United States Congressman from Wisconsin from 1899 to 1903.
Background
Herman Bjorn Dahle was born in the town of Perry, Dane County, Wisconsin. He received his education in the district schools of his native town and in what is now the University of Wisconsin–Madison, where he graduated in 1877. He resided at Mount Vernon, Wisconsin from 1877 to 1888 where he conducted a general mercantile business. He was also the principal owner of the Mount Horeb bank beginning in 1890.His former home, now known as the Herman B. and Anne Marie Dahle House, is list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
